Accumulating First-Party Information
First-party information comes directly from customers and audiences on a brand's had networks. It's usually one of the most important and dependable type of data.

Marketers collect first-party information via internet and mobile apps, CRM systems, point of sale (POS) systems, email advertising and marketing, and customer accounts, to name a few sources. The more data collection approaches made use of, the a lot more robust and complete a brand name's understanding of its target market will certainly be. Nevertheless, it's also easy for details to end up being siloed as the number of data collection resources boosts.

When it concerns collecting first-party information, marketing experts require a clear technique in place. One vital concept to remember is that users will just want to provide their call and various other information if there's value traded in return. This can be accomplished through motivations like vouchers, loyalty programs, gated costs material, and so on. These incentives can go a long way to enhancing addressability and building durable client relationships.

Making Use Of First-Party Information
First-party data is information that your organization collects straight from customers/audiences. This includes details gathered from your website, applications, CRM systems, client assistance procedures and other straight interactions in between you and your audience.

This information is extremely valuable since it offers actual understandings into visitor/customer demographics, behavioral patterns and various other key aspects that drive marketing projects. It can help you to develop high-value target audiences based upon combined actions signals, purchase information and demographic understandings. This information can additionally be used to maximize ad invest and pipeline.

The secret to effectively utilizing first-party data is focusing on the worth exchange for your audience. Individuals are much more happy to share their personal information if there is a noticeable value exchange such as tailored content or special deals. Also, it is important to make sure that you are transparent concerning how the information will certainly be used to ensure that your target market feels secure sharing their information with you.

Evaluating First-Party Information
First-party information can help your company attain its marketing objectives. It can be made use of for personalization, enhancing advertisement targeting and more. It likewise assists your business build more powerful customer connections. However it's important to start with clear goals.

One means to collect and evaluate first-party information is to make use of website types that enable consumers to provide their name, email address and rate of interests. This information can after that be used to create high-value sections for advertisement targeting.

An additional means to optimize first-party data is to keep it systematized in a CDP or CRM to make certain consistency. It's also essential to have a clear personal privacy plan and be clear about how the data will be utilized. This assists make certain conformity and builds trust with customers. It's likewise crucial to consistently assess and test your information collection and analysis. That will enable you to make improvements and boost efficiency with time.
